    Abstract: An integrated circuit has voltage generating circuitry for generating an on-chip voltage from a supply voltage in response to clock pulses. Clock control circuitry controls transmission of the clock pulses to the voltage generating circuitry. The clock control circuitry receives a reference voltage and a digital offset value comprising a binary numeric value identifying an offset. The clock control circuitry suppresses transmission of the clock pulses if the on-chip voltage is greater than the sum of the reference voltage and the offset identified by the digital offset value, to reduce power consumption. The offset can be tuned digitally to vary the average level of the on-chip voltage. A similar digital tuning mechanism may be used in a clocked comparator to compare a first voltage with a digitally tunable threshold voltage.

    Abstract: A method is provided for forming a gasket for sealing opposing flange surfaces of a pipe having corrosive fluid flowing therethrough. The method comprises defining a gasket profile incorporating a serrated profile core having a flange extending radially inward therefrom. A deformable pillow extends radially inward from the serrated profile core, to define a gasket intermediate portion about the flange, and a gasket inner portion radially inward from the flange. The deformable pillow material and thickness are selected such that upon compression to a thickness no less than the core thickness, the gasket inner portion exhibits a stress level sufficient to preclude corrosive liquid flowing through the pipe from passing radially outward beyond the gasket inner portion, and the gasket intermediate portion exhibits a stress level sufficient to preclude gas and liquid flowing through the pipe from passing radially outward beyond the gasket intermediate portion.

    Abstract: A method and system for an inductively powering rail on a firearm to power accessories such as: telescopic sights, tactical sights, laser sighting modules, and night vision scopes. This is achieved by having primary and secondary electromagnets (U-Cores) on both the inductively powering rail and the accessory. Once the electromagnets are in contact, the accessory is able to obtain power through induction via the inductively powering rail. Accessories may be attached to various fixture points on the inductively powering rail and are detected by the firearm when attached and detached. When attached, power and data communications may flow between the accessory and a master CPU located on the firearm. Accessories that are attached to the inductively powering rail and have rechargeable power systems may be recharged via the inductive power rail. Further, accessories that have power that is not needed may be transferred to other accessories.
